The Spoons of Destiny (Japanese: 運命のスプーン曲げ Spoon Bend of Fate), known as Spoons of Fate in the Chuang Yi translation, are items in the Pokémon Adventures manga. During the battle against the Elite Four on Cerise Island, Sabrina's Alakazam created these magical spoons. The Spoons of Destiny would point out a Trainer of a similar style and personality. Using these tools, Blue was paired with Koga, Yellow was paired with Blaine, Red was paired with Lt. Surge, and Sabrina herself was paired with Green. However, with Red absent due to injuries, Lt. Surge picked Bill as his partner instead, even though Bill's spoon was not bent, indicating that he did not have a will to fight.

In the Gold, Silver & Crystal arc, Red was given a Spoon of Destiny at Mt. Silver to help locate the Gym Leaders that were trapped in the train. This Spoon later led him and Blue to the Ilex Forest to aid in the battle against the Masked Man.

In the Black 2 & White 2 arc, Sabrina gave Whitley a Spoon of Destiny to help her pick a movie to star in at Pokéstar Studios. Despite Whitley's instance in not wanting to act, the spoon picked a Brycen-Man movie.
